In automated environments, selecting a stepper motor involves reconciling two key factors: positioning resolution and output torque. While standard stepper motors excel at discrete, high-resolution movement, their torque output degrades significantly as rotation speed increases. Integrating a planetary or spur gearbox solves this by offering torque multiplication and speed reduction.
Planetary Gearboxes (e.g., GMP10, GMP36 series) distribute mechanical loads evenly across multiple satellite gears. This coaxial configuration results in incredibly high power density, exceptional torque limits, and minimal backlash, making it suitable for automotive throttle positioning and medical dosage pumps. Spur Gearboxes (e.g., GM12, GM20 series) utilize inline gears. While their torque capacity is lower compared to planetary types, they are highly cost-efficient and exhibit lower frictional losses, making them ideal for high-volume deployments like commercial surveillance cameras and IP PTZ control rigs.
| Feature / Parameter | Spur Gearbox Config (GM Series) | Planetary Gearbox Config (GMP Series) | Ideal Hungarian Industrial Application |
|---|---|---|---|
| Mechanical Efficiency | Up to 90% per stage | 75% - 85% per stage (Load dependent) | Portable diagnostics, battery-powered systems |
| Torque Density | Moderate (Max 10-20 kg.cm) | High (Up to 100 kg.cm in GMP36) | Automotive actuators, smart grid valves |
| Backlash Window | 1.5° - 3.0° | < 0.5° - 1.2° | Robotic arms, precise optical positioning |
| System Life Cycle | Standard (~2,000 hours) | Extended (~5,000+ hours with steel gears) | Continuous production lines, industrial doors |
Micro stepper motors typically generate significant heat during continuous holding states. Our engineering team addresses this by using Class H magnet wire (rated up to 180°C) and advanced synthetic lubricants. This prevents thermal degradation, allowing Hungarian system integrators to install these motors inside enclosed compartments like engine bays and IP67-rated outdoor camera housings without worrying about premature coil breakdown.
